Something I put together to get a gauge for how certain types of geometry features might print at different sizes. Hardy scientific, but still useful for reference. Since the horizontal resolution of a Makerbot isn't so great I've set it up to be printed vertically at a 15 degree angle with a supporting structure, which seems to be working well. I'm including a flat version in case anyone wants to print it horizontally or modify it in any way.Currently printing this in ABS using 40mm/s feed rate and 0.2 mm layer height. Even the thinnest wall thickness show up OK at that resolution.
